Research Diagnostic Sonographer Job Trends in Wailuku

If you’re a Diagnostic Sonographer curious about Travel job trends in Wailuku, HI,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 2 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,034 and a range from $1,556 to $2,550 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 96793, at reputable facilities such as Maui Memorial Hospital.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Diagnostic Sonographers in Wailuku’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Diagnostic Sonographers Expect in Wailuku, HI?

As a Diagnostic Sonographer in Wailuku, Hawaii, you will have the opportunity to work in a variety of healthcare settings, including hospitals, outpatient clinics, and specialized imaging centers. Your role will involve performing high-quality diagnostic ultrasound examinations to assist in the assessment and diagnosis of medical conditions, collaborating closely with physicians and healthcare teams to deliver exceptional patient care. Facilities in the area may include the Maui Memorial Medical Center, where you can engage in a diverse range of cases, or smaller clinics focusing on outpatient services, allowing for a more personalized approach to patient interactions. Whether you are capturing images of the heart, abdomen, or obstetric examinations, you will play a crucial role in the healthcare continuum, contributing to the well-being of the Wailuku community in the picturesque setting of Maui.

Start your next assignment as a Travel General Sonographer in Portland, OR, where you’ll perform ultrasound imaging across a variety of specialties and support patient care in a dynamic healthcare environment. This long-term contract runs 39 to 52 weeks, with 40 hours per week and possible on-call shifts. To qualify, you need at least 1 year of experience, an Oregon or other state license, certification in sonography, BLS, and two references. Experience in all areas of sonography is required, and VA experience is preferred. As a general sonographer, you’ll prepare patients, operate ultrasound equipment, analyze images, and collaborate with physicians for accurate diagnoses. You’ll maintain equipment and adhere to safety standards while adapting to different clinical protocols[1]?[2]. Travel Diagnostic Sonographer jobs in Des Moines, IA offer a weekend package with 12-hour night shifts from 8pm to 8am Friday through Sunday. You will prepare and maintain exam rooms, position patients, operate GE and Siemens imaging equipment, and review diagnostic images, including pediatric exams such as heads, spine, pyloric stenosis, and intussusception. This position requires at least 24 months of general ultrasound experience, proficiency in pediatric exams, AB discipline on ARDMS, EPIC electronic medical systems experience, and first-time travelers are welcome.
